Introduction to Buliya Island Camping
Buliya Island, part of Fiji’s Kadavu archipelago, offers a unique opportunity for eco-conscious travelers seeking a budget island camping experience. This untouched paradise is renowned for its vibrant coral reefs, pristine beaches, and lush tropical landscapes. Camping on Buliya Island allows visitors to immerse themselves in nature while enjoying sustainable travel practices. Choosing the Right Campsite
Selecting a suitable campsite is crucial for a sustainable beach camping experience on Buliya. Opt for established camping areas to minimize your impact on the environment. Avoid disturbing native flora and fauna by setting up camp at a safe distance from wildlife habitats. Additionally, ensure that your chosen camping spot is elevated and away from the shoreline to prevent any potential harm to marine ecosystems.
Minimizing Waste
Waste management is a core component of eco-friendly camping. Carry reusable items such as water bottles, cutlery, and food containers to reduce the need for single-use plastics. Implement a strict “Leave No Trace” policy by packing out all trash and biodegradable waste. Engage in beach clean-ups during your stay to contribute positively to the island’s environment and inspire fellow campers.
Eco-Friendly Cooking Practices
Sustainable cooking is essential for a budget island camping adventure. Use a portable stove instead of open fires to prevent damage to vegetation and reduce fire hazards. Source local and organic ingredients to support the island’s economy and minimize transportation emissions. Remember to dispose of food scraps responsibly, ensuring they do not attract wildlife or contaminate the area.
Water Conservation Techniques
Freshwater is a precious resource, especially on remote islands like Buliya. Practice conservation by using biodegradable soaps and limiting shower time. Collect rainwater for non-potable uses and ensure all detergent runoff is kept away from natural water sources. By being mindful of your water usage, you contribute to the sustainability of the island’s limited resources.
Respecting Local Culture and Wildlife
Respect for local customs and wildlife is vital when camping on Buliya. Engage with the community to learn about traditional practices and seek permission before exploring sacred sites. Observe wildlife from a distance to avoid disrupting their natural behaviors. Your respectful conduct not only enriches your experience but also supports the island’s cultural preservation.
Sustainable Transportation Options
Getting to Buliya Island can be part of your eco-friendly journey. Opt for shared transportation options like public ferries or group charters to reduce carbon emissions. Once on the island, explore on foot or by bicycle to minimize your environmental impact and fully appreciate the natural beauty of the island.
